At First Due, we’re transforming the way Fire and EMS agencies prepare for, respond to, and recover from emergencies. Our all-in-one, cloud-based platform brings mission-critical data to the frontlines—streamlining operations, improving response times, and ultimately saving lives. With a growing customer base and increasing demand for high-availability secure systems, we’re looking for a talented FedRAMP Infrastructure Engineer to help scale and secure the backbone of our platform and help manage our FedRAMP / IL5 environments.
As A FedRAMP Infrastructure Engineer, you will play a critical role in ensuring the reliability, performance, and security of our FedRAMP / IL5 authorized systems as well as performing code updates, troubleshooting, and data deployments. You will manage key aspects of our infrastructure, from Linux systems and PostgreSQL databases to cloud services and automation pipelines. This role involves close collaboration with our Development and Federal teams to support government-grade FedRAMP / IL5 Authorized Environments.

The Role
As a FedRAMP Infrastructure Engineer, you will support the following areas:
· Deployment & Federal Support
- Support application deployments, updates, patching, and troubleshooting across FedRAMP / IL 5 authorized environments.
- Provide 24/7 support for critical infrastructure issues in FedRAMP / IL5 authorized environments.
· PostgreSQL Administration
- Maintain and optimize PostgreSQL databases for high availability, performance, and security in FedRAMP / IL5 Authorized environments.
- Implement and manage replication, backups, clustering, and disaster recovery strategies.
· Linux Systems Management
- Administer Debian-based servers including package management, kernel tuning, security patching, and service management
- Monitor system performance and identify real-time bottlenecks or resource constraints.
- Knowledge of Ubuntu Pro
· Infrastructure Automation & Scripting
- Develop Bash scripts to automate routine administrative tasks.
- Use Ansible to manage infrastructure as code across environments.
- Experience with Version Control Systems (Git)
· Web Server & Application Infrastructure
- Install, configure, and secure NGINX or other web servers.
- Manage and configure additional services including REDIS, Postfix, NFS, Supervisor etc.
- Manage SSL/TLS, and load balancing setups.
· Cloud Infrastructure (AWS/GCP)
· Design and maintain scalable, cost-effective cloud architectures using AWS (EC2, RDS, IAM, VPC, S3) or GCP.
· Monitoring & Troubleshooting
· Set up infrastructure and performance monitoring tools.
· Diagnose and resolve complex system and network issues.
Skills, Experience, and Qualifications
The ideal candidate will have:
· 7+ years of experience in Linux system administration (preferably Debian-based systems).
· DoD Active Clearance - Minimum Secret Level and DoD 8570 IAT LII or 8140
· Experience working in or supporting FedRAMP High or DoD IL5 environments.
· Strong Bash scripting and automation skills.
· Proficiency with configuration management tools like Ansible.
· Deep experience with PostgreSQL performance tuning, replication, and recovery.
· Cloud infrastructure experience with AWS and/or GCP, including infrastructure-as-code.
· Experience with deploying and securing web applications using NGINX.
· Familiarity with monitoring tools and methodologies (e.g., Prometheus, Grafana, ELK, etc.).
· Proven ability to troubleshoot performance, latency, and availability issues across a distributed stack.
· Knowledge of server hardening, secure configurations, and compliance best practices.
· Bachelor's degree in Computer Science, Computer Engineering, or a related field.
· Familiarity with secure cloud architectures and zero-trust principles.
